Hotel extras

  • Rooftop pool with panoramic 360° view of Athens and Acropolis Hill

  • 5 minutes' walk from the closest metro station; easily access to airport and port of Piraeus.

  • Onsite indoor parking and fitness center

  • Food & Drink options with international and Mediterranean flavors

  • Congress Hotel with 8 ergonomic meeting rooms from 10-620sp.m, suitable for up to 1.300 people

Hotel of horrors with aggressive staff

TripAdvisor rating 1.0/5

IsobelGP TripAdvisor review

Our recent stay at Novotel Athens, part of an organised group traveling for work on Athens' financial ecosystem for tech, was profoundly disappointing. We had previously enjoyed excellent accommodations in corporate hotels in Prague and Warsaw. Unfortunately, our experience at Novotel Athens was quite the opposite. Upon arrival, my partner attempted to check us in, as we had done at all previous hotels. However, just as the receptionist was about to give him the key, another receptionist, who was aggressive, rude, and condescending, abruptly intervened and told him to sit down (witnessed by other members of our group). Our event organiser eventually handed out the keys. When we reached our room, we were met with a stale cigarette smell and a door that had clearly been previously damaged through force. I stayed with the luggage while my partner requested a room change. The second room we were assigned smelled of drains and dampness. My partner once again requested a room change. Finally, in our third room, I attempted to connect to the Wi-Fi but couldn't find an access code. When I called reception, I was curtly told to check the key card. After finding no code, I called back and was told I needed to come to reception. When I did, the receptionist aggressively insisted the code had been provided and blamed the room changes for the issue. She then diverted the request stating that our booking was for only one person, despite our group lead verifying that my name was indeed on the reservation, she continued to be unhelpful and dismissive. The situation escalated when I asked to speak with a manager. The receptionist smirked and claimed no manager was available. After insisting, she finally called someone and then stated that nobody was available. Someone then came, who then revealed themselves as the manager in an aggressive manner. His behavior was threatening, and he even falsely claimed to call the police when I tried to record the interaction for my safety. This distressing encounter left me in tears and feeling threatened. Over 20% of our group left the hotel within 24 hours due to the unsanitary conditions and the hostile behavior of these two staff members, which overshadowed the efforts of the more courteous staff. I will never stay at this hotel again and will be lodging a formal complaint with Novotel's CEO. This experience was beyond comprehension and unacceptable by any standard of hospitality. Furthermore the surrounding area is awful.
